A THANKSGIVING GIFT:  Donald Trump to host Wounded Iraq and
Afghanistan Veterans of the FREEDOM TEAM prior to competition in
Marathon of the Palm Beaches

 

Achilles Freedom Team of Wounded Veterans
3rd Annual Evening Welcome Reception
6 - 9 PM
December 5, 2008

 

 

 Palm Beach, FL - Far away from the battlefield, members of the Achilles FREEDOM TEAM of Wounded Veterans, including 5 local veterans from the VA Medical Center, will have an opportunity to enjoy the view, the spectacular cuisine, and most importantly, golf the “Championship 18” of Trump International Golf Club, on Friday, December 5, 2008, courtesy of Donald J. Trump.  Successful in business, he still has a lot of heart for our troops this Thanksgiving.

 

“Thanksgiving is about giving thanks, and I am grateful for all the men and women who have allowed me to live in freedom in this wonderful country.  I personally thank each and every one of you for what you have done for me and for this nation.  Your sacrifice is not in vain nor is it unnoticed,” says Mr. Trump

 

Master Pro Dr. Gary Wiren will provide golf lessons to the wounded veterans, most who are amputees preparing as a team to compete in the Dec 7th Marathon of the Palm Beaches.  After the Friday morning lesson, there will be a buffet lunch on the outdoor terrace for all the “TEE-OFF with the VETS” tournament golfers, vets, and their family members who are here with them to witness their athletic achievement over the weekend; on the greens and two days later, the 26.2 mile course of the Marathon of the Palm Beaches.  Patriotic events  are planned prior to the 12:15 Shotgun of this inaugural tournament.  Other Palm Beach supporters include Jana & John Scarpa, Alfons Schmidt, Howard & Michele Kessler, Robert Garvy of Intech, David McCourt, Hall of Famer Jim Palmer, JC & Marty Meyers, George Cloutier & Tiffany Spadafora, Phil Byrnes and John Biondo.

 

The evening at Trump offers an opportunity for all others in the community to ‘meet and greet’ the wounded vets at the Evening Welcome Reception Benefit beginning at 6PM. There will be a light dinner buffet, wine bar courtesy of Southern Wines, special entertainment from United We Sing and an opportunity to hear from a few of the FREEDOM TEAM members.  All evening reception tickets are $375. To reserve, call 561-659-0873.

 

On Sunday, December 7th, twenty-nine athletes with disabilities from Achilles, including severely wounded veterans from Iraq and Afghanistan of the Freedom Team will line up early to demonstrate their strength and courage in the Marathon of the Palm Beaches.   Many without limbs, or suffering from paralysis will be in the handcrank wheelchair division that starts off early at 5:50 am, ten minutes before the regular start of the able-bodied runners. 

 

At least five of the veterans joining the FREEDOM TEAM this year are from the local VA Hospital on Blue Herron.  “This year we’re very excited about integrating more local veterans into the FREEDOM TEAM” says Mary Bryant, who is the Founder and Director of the team, and Vice President of Achilles International.   “Previously, most of our members came directly from the major military hospitals, such as Walter Reed, yet now we’ve opened the Achilles program up to the local VA since the community of the Palm Beaches is so supportive of our efforts!”

 

Along with Achilles South Florida regulars from Miami, Lance Benson (a successful commercial real-estate broker with Grub & Ellis born without legs competes on a skateboard) and Juan Carlos Gil (mobility and visually impaired), you’ll find Achilles members from Boynton Beach, Palm Beach Gardens, and Greenacres!  For them, it will be a first time experience to take on a full marathon

About Achilles   

Achilles International, is dedicated to enabling people with all types of disabilities to participate in mainstream athletics, thereby promoting personal achievement, enhanced self-esteem, and the lowering of barriers between able-bodied and disabled people. Founded in 1983 as a running club, this worldwide organization is represented in over 70 countries.

The “Achilles Freedom Team of Wounded Vets” is comprised mainly of young men and women from Walter Reed Army Medical Center, Brooke Army Medical Center and Balboa Naval Hospital who have been wounded in Iraq or Afghanistan.   Achilles provides for race training and entries, financial and educational support, and encouragement and team spirit, and its members participate in wide variety of athletic events such as marathons, runs, biathlons, triathlons, bike races and tours and swimming meets around the nation and the world.
